Ready for a rewarding career in the finance industry? The Certificate IV in Accounting and Bookkeeping is the perfect place to start.

Through 13 units of study, the course delivers practical knowledge of a variety of accounting and bookkeeping tasks performed in the workplace, including completion of BAS, preparation of financial reports, processing financial transactions, and establishing and maintaining a payroll system.

Delivered online, it is a nationally accredited and recognised course - great for those who need flexibility to complete their studies. If you who want to expand existing skills in accounts and bookkeeping, this TPB approved course is for you.

Designed to be completed in 12 months, upon completion you'll have the real-world skills, knowledge and hands-on experience needed to succeed in the accounting and bookkeeping industry. The Certificate IV is also a direct pathway to the FNS50222 Diploma of Accounting. You will gain credits from your qualification to enter the Diploma of Accounting, making the course duration more efficient.

The Certificate IV in Accounting and Bookkeeping includes 13 units. The topics include Accounting Fundamentals; Effective Work Practices; Payroll, Activity Statements and Software; Calculations, Budgets and Tax.

Study Tips from NBIA Students


  1. Invest 5-10 hours per week in studying

  2. Meet with your trainer/assessor regularly

  3. Ask as many questions as you need for clarity

  4. Develop proficient research skills by practicing and saving key web links

  5. Join the student Facebook group for support and collaboration

  6. Join the IPA as a student member and start building your industry network
